What is yellow fever?
Yellow fever is a viral disease transmitted by mosquitoes, primarily affecting tropical areas of Africa and South America.
What is the yellow fever vaccine?
The yellow fever vaccine is a live-attenuated vaccine that provides immunity against the yellow fever virus.
Who needs the yellow fever vaccine?
Individuals traveling to yellow fever-endemic areas and healthcare workers in those regions are required to get the vaccine.
How effective is the yellow fever vaccine?
The yellow fever vaccine is highly effective, providing immunity in about 99% of individuals after a single dose.
Is the yellow fever vaccine safe?
Yes, the yellow fever vaccine is generally safe, with side effects being rare and mild in most individuals.
How is the yellow fever vaccine administered?
The yellow fever vaccine is administered as a single dose through an injection.
When should I get the yellow fever vaccine?
It is recommended to get the yellow fever vaccine at least 10 days before traveling to an endemic area.
How long does immunity last after the yellow fever vaccine?
Immunity from the yellow fever vaccine typically lasts for 10 years or more.
Can children receive the yellow fever vaccine?
Yes, children aged 9 months and older are eligible to receive the yellow fever vaccine.
What are the side effects of the yellow fever vaccine?
Common side effects include mild fever, headache, and soreness at the injection site.
